These -

Used to indicate specific items or people near the speaker

예: These books are mine.
사용: formal문맥: academic or professional settings
메모: 'These' is used to refer to items or people that are physically close to the speaker.

Used as a pronoun to refer to specific items or people near the speaker

예: I will take these.
사용: informal문맥: everyday conversations
메모: In this case, 'these' is used as a pronoun to replace a noun that has already been mentioned or is understood from context.

Used to introduce a list of items or ideas

예: These are the main points we need to discuss.
사용: formal문맥: presentations or written reports
메모: 'These' is commonly used to introduce a list of items, ideas, or points for discussion or consideration.

These 표현, 자주 쓰이는 구문

These days

Refers to the current time or period.
예: These days, most people prefer to shop online rather than in physical stores.
메모: The phrase 'these days' indicates a specific time frame, whereas 'these' alone refers to a specific set of things or people.

These are the days

Indicates that the current period is significant or memorable.
예: These are the days we'll always remember.
메모: The phrase 'these are the days' emphasizes the significance or importance of the current period.

These ones

Used to specify a particular set of things among others.
예: I prefer these ones over those ones.
메모: Adding 'ones' after 'these' clarifies that you are referring to specific items.

These things happen

Acknowledges that certain events or situations are unavoidable or common.
예: I'm not happy about it, but I guess these things happen.
메모: The phrase 'these things happen' implies a sense of acceptance or resignation towards certain occurrences.

These are the facts

Asserts the truth or reality of a situation.
예: I know you don't like it, but these are the facts.
메모: Using 'these are the facts' emphasizes the indisputable nature of the information being presented.

These boots are made for walking

Refers to something being suitable or intended for a particular purpose.
예: These boots are made for walking, and that's just what they'll do.
메모: This phrase is a line from a popular song and is used metaphorically to suggest that something is meant to be used for a specific purpose.

These things take time

Emphasizes that certain processes or achievements require patience and cannot be rushed.
예: Don't rush it, these things take time to accomplish.
메모: The phrase 'these things take time' stresses the importance of allowing sufficient time for completion or success.
